Context
The arrest highlights ongoing concerns about Iran's involvement in arms trafficking and its implications for regional stability in Africa. S1S2
Key points
- The woman, Shamim Mafi, was arrested at Los Angeles International Airport. S2
- She is accused of dealing weapons on behalf of the Iranian government. S2
- Federal agents detained her during an operation related to arms trafficking. S1
- The charges suggest a broader network of Iranian arms dealings in Africa. S2
- The case raises questions about Iran's influence and activities in the region. S1
- Mafi's arrest is part of ongoing investigations into international arms trafficking. S2
- The federal prosecutor in Los Angeles announced the charges against her. S2
- This incident underscores the risks associated with arms trafficking and international relations. S1
Why it matters
- The arrest could have implications for U.S.-Iran relations amid ongoing tensions. S1
- It highlights the challenges of controlling arms trafficking linked to state actors. S2
- The situation may affect security dynamics in Africa, particularly in Sudan. S2
